The reception of an Ambassador by the Grand Vizier at Topkapi Palace, Constantinople
AGN356197 The reception of an Ambassador by the Grand Vizier at Topkapi Palace, Constantinople, 1790 (w/c & bodycolour with chalk, pen and ink on paper) by Lespinasse, Louis-Nicolas de (1734-1808); 25.3x39.1 cm; Private Collection; (add.info.: the Grand Vizier was the most senior minister of the Sultan; ); Photo eAgnew s, London; French, out of copyright

The Reception of an Ambassador by the Grand Vizier at Topkapi Palace, Constantinople: A Glimpse into Ottoman Diplomacy In this photo print, we are transported back to the vibrant and opulent world of 18th-century Constantinople. The scene unfolds within the magnificent walls of Topkapi Palace, where a momentous event is taking place - the reception of an esteemed ambassador by none other than the Grand Vizier himself. The composition is rich in detail and color, showcasing Louis-Nicolas de Lespinasse's masterful use of watercolor and bodycolour techniques. Every brushstroke brings to life a gathering that epitomizes oriental splendor and grandeur. Dressed in traditional Turkish costumes, diplomats from various nations stand alongside courtiers adorned with elaborate ceremonial attire. This visual spectacle not only captures a significant historical moment but also offers us a glimpse into international diplomacy during the height of the Ottoman Empire.
